1. La Mangeoire Restaurant and Piano Bar

Location
Courchevel 1850

This restaurant and piano bar remains one of the most popular places to eat in Courchevel 1850.

Expensive, but with a great atmosphere and is well reputed to have good food. After midnight the DJ pumps up the music and the party begins. They have an extensive wine list for you to enjoy and the menu includes typical French cuisine and local specialities such as fondue. The name translates as 'The Feeder'.

Hyped as being one of the best nights out in Courchevel, if good food and good music are your thing then stock up your wallet and give it a go!

Dinner served between 20:15 and 22:15. Open in winter only.

2. Copiña Tapas Bar

Location
Courchevel 1650

Following on from the success of Copiña in Méribel, they opened Copiña Courchevel in 2018, bringing a Spanish-inspired tapas and cocktail experience to the heart of Courchevel 1650. Housed in the former Arc en Ciel restaurant, the venue features a larger kitchen and dining area than its Méribel sister, offering both a bustling bar à l'Espagnol for lively tapas and raciones, and a cosy sit-down restaurant for a three-course meal.

Literally meaning ‘a small drink’, Copiña provides a rare and exciting Spanish-influenced drinking and dining experience. Guests can enjoy an impressive range of drinks, from innovative, homemade cocktails to hand-selected craft beers and world wines, with six rotating beers on tap and up to ten wines available by the glass.

The Iberian influence shines on the menu, with fresh, high-quality Spanish ingredients. Iconic jamón Ibérico, cheese and meat planchas, and classic tapas sit alongside new Spanish-inspired raciones and main courses with a cosmopolitan twist.

An elegant marble bar greets visitors, while the intimate restaurant showcases the vibrant feasting style of Galician family dining. Perfectly paired with creative cocktails, Copiña Courchevel offers a relaxed yet lively atmosphere where Spanish flavours and conviviality take centre stage.
